Abstract
A monitoring system for combined heat and power (CHP) units ( ) has a main monitoring computer ( ) at a remote central location connected to the CHP units ( ). Data is processed and energy management information, as well as repair and maintenance procedures, can be derived by the remote and local computers ( ). Energy management information can also be obtained locally by means of a PC connected by a dial-up or network link ( ) to a data access device ( b) of the local computer ( ).
